There's two things which add on the toughness of denim – the yarn twist along with the twill weave. The large twist from the fibers spun into yarn to make denim, plus the more powerful twill weave utilized to construct the fabric (it looks like a diagonal ribbed sample), lead to a really sturdy completed fabric (resource).

The jacquard procedure can even be applied to generate brocades and damasks, which at the time necessary countless hours of painstaking labor to weave by hand. With the advent of the jacquard loom, these fabrics were now not reserved for Culture’s elite. Jacquard’s punched-card approach also had implications outside the planet of textiles. His groundbreaking design and style was an excellent source of inspiration for Charles Babbage, who invented the very first mechanical Pc during the 1820s.
